Understanding the Importance of English Pronunciation
Clear English pronunciation is essential for effective communication. Mispronounced words can lead to misunderstandings, reduce listener engagement, and sometimes cause embarrassment for learners. Improving English pronunciation helps learners:
- Enhance clarity and intelligibility in conversation
- Build confidence in speaking situations
- Improve listening comprehension by recognizing correct sounds
- Facilitate smoother interactions with native speakers
Many learners struggle with pronunciation due to differences in their native language’s phonetic system. Recognizing this challenge is the first step toward mastering English pronunciation.
Common Challenges in English Pronunciation
English pronunciation can be complex because of its irregular spelling rules and variety of accents. Some common difficulties include:
1. Vowel Sounds
English has approximately 20 vowel sounds, many of which do not exist in other languages. Differentiating between short and long vowels, such as /ɪ/ in “ship” versus /iː/ in “sheep,” can be challenging.
2. Consonant Clusters
Many learners find it difficult to pronounce consonant clusters like “str” in “street” or “spl” in “splash,” which may not occur in their first language.
3. Word Stress and Intonation
English is a stress-timed language, meaning the rhythm depends on stressed and unstressed syllables. Incorrect stress placement can change meanings or make speech sound unnatural.
4. The “th” Sounds
The dental fricatives /θ/ (as in “think”) and /ð/ (as in “this”) are uncommon worldwide and often replaced by /s/, /t/, or /d/, which may confuse listeners.
Effective Techniques to Improve English Pronunciation
Improving English pronunciation requires consistent practice and the use of targeted techniques. Here are some effective strategies:
1. Listen Actively and Imitate
Listening to native speakers through podcasts, videos, and conversations helps learners internalize correct pronunciation. Imitation exercises, where learners repeat phrases exactly as heard, can improve accent and intonation.
2. Practice Phonetic Sounds Using the IPA
The International Phonetic Alphabet (IPA) provides symbols for every sound in English. Familiarity with IPA helps learners identify how words are pronounced and practice difficult sounds systematically.
3. Record and Playback Your Speech
Recording yourself speaking and comparing it to native speakers is an effective way to notice errors and track progress. This method encourages self-correction and greater awareness of pronunciation details.
4. Break Words into Syllables
Dividing words into syllables and practicing each part slowly before speeding up helps learners master difficult words. This technique also aids in understanding word stress patterns.
5. Use Minimal Pairs to Differentiate Sounds
Minimal pairs are pairs of words that differ by a single sound, such as “ship” and “sheep.” Practicing minimal pairs trains the ear and mouth to distinguish and produce different sounds accurately.
6. Focus on Intonation and Rhythm
Practicing the natural rise and fall of English speech and its rhythm makes pronunciation more fluent and understandable. Shadowing exercises, where learners repeat speech immediately after hearing it, are particularly useful.

Tips for Consistent Pronunciation Improvement
Consistency is key when aiming to improve English pronunciation. Here are some practical tips:
- Practice Daily: Even 10-15 minutes of focused pronunciation practice each day can lead to significant improvement.
- Set Specific Goals: Target particular sounds or aspects of pronunciation to avoid feeling overwhelmed.
- Use Visual Aids: Watching mouth movements and using mirrors can help replicate correct articulation.
- Be Patient and Persistent: Pronunciation skills develop over time, so maintain a positive and persistent attitude.
- Engage in Real Conversations: Apply your skills in everyday communication to reinforce learning.
